Organization of Afro-American Unity


 

The Organization of Afro-American Unity was formed by Malcolm X on June 28, 1964. The organization lasted until the death of its founder in February 1965. It is said to be a split from the Nation of Islam, as it was formed shortly after its founder left that group and was designed to have less strict rules and religious sacrifices. At its peak the secular group had several hundred members and supporters.
